解决“yarn vue --version不是内部”错误的步骤
1. 检查是否安装了 Yarn
在开始解决这个问题之前,首先需要确认你已经正确安装了 Yarn。如果没有安装 Yarn,可以从官方网站( yarn --version
来检查 Yarn 是否已经正确安装。
2. 检查是否安装了 Vue CLI
由于你遇到了 yarn vue --version不是内部
的问题,我们可以推测你可能没有安装 Vue CLI。Vue CLI 是一个官方推荐的用于开发 Vue.js 应用程序的脚手架工具。你需要使用下面的命令来检查是否安装了 Vue CLI:
vue --version
如果你没有安装 Vue CLI,你需要通过下面的命令来全局安装 Vue CLI:
npm install -g @vue/cli
3. 检查环境变量配置
在某些情况下,你可能会遇到 yarn vue --version不是内部
的错误,这是因为系统无法找到 yarn 的路径。为了解决这个问题,你可以检查你的环境变量配置是否正确。
首先,你需要找到你的 yarn 安装路径。在命令行中运行下面的命令:
where yarn
上面的命令将会返回 yarn 的安装路径,例如 C:\Program Files (x86)\Yarn\bin\yarn
。接下来,你需要将这个路径添加到你的环境变量中。
-
对于 Windows 用户:
- 在开始菜单中搜索并打开“环境变量”。
- 在“系统变量”下找到名为“Path”的变量,并双击进行编辑。
- 在变量值的末尾添加 yarn 的安装路径,例如
;C:\Program Files (x86)\Yarn\bin
。 - 点击“确定”保存更改。
-
对于 macOS 和 Linux 用户:
- 在终端中运行下面的命令打开
.bashrc
文件:
nano ~/.bashrc
- 在文件的末尾添加以下行:
export PATH="$PATH:/opt/yarn-[version]/bin"
请将
[version]
替换为你的 yarn 版本号。 3. 按下Ctrl + X
保存并退出文件。 - 在终端中运行下面的命令打开
4. 验证解决方案
完成上述步骤后,你应该能够成功运行 yarn vue --version
命令了。在命令行中运行该命令,你将看到类似下面的输出:
@vue/cli 4.5.11
恭喜你,问题已经解决了!
希望这篇文章对你解决 yarn vue --version不是内部
的问题有所帮助。如果你有任何其他问题或疑问,请随时向我提问。